Location Overview

The Antriksh Parshwanath Temple is located in Shirpur (Jain) town in Akola district, Maharashtra, India.

This temple is well-connected by road and accessible from major cities in the region. Known for its stunning architecture and spiritual ambiance, it draws visitors from across the country.

By Air

The nearest airport to the Antriksh Parshwanath Temple is Jalgaon (JLG) Airport. It is approximately 88.5 kilometers away from the temple.

  1. Flights Available: Several domestic airlines connect Jalgaon (JLG) Airport with major cities.
  2. Distance from Airport: The temple is about 88.5 kilometers from the airport.
  3. Transportation Options: After landing, you can hire a taxi, book a ride through app-based services, or use local buses to reach the temple. The journey typically takes around 4 hours.
  4. Alternate Airport Options: If direct flights are unavailable, consider nearby airports such as Nashik, which is 395 KM away and offers additional connectivity.

By Train

The nearest railway station to the temple is Washim. It is 30 kilometers away from the temple.

  1. Train Connectivity: Trains from major cities like New Delhi connect to Washim railway station.

By Road

Reaching the Antriksh Parshwanath Temple by road is convenient.

  1. Nearest Major City: The temple is 70km from Akola city.
  2. Highway Connectivity: The route is accessible via NH161 and Risod – Malegoan – Akola Rd, offering scenic views and smooth roads.
  3. Bus Services: Regular buses operate from nearby cities. You can board a bus to the nearest bus stop at Akola Bus Stand and take local transport to the temple.
  4. Driving Directions: Use GPS services for precise directions. The roads are well-maintained and offer a smooth journey.
  5. Private Vehicles: Hiring a cab or using your vehicle allows greater flexibility in planning your visit.

Best Time to Visit

The best time to visit the Antriksh Parshwanath Temple is during the early mornings or late evenings to avoid the heat. The temple is most vibrant during festivals and special occasions, when devotees gather in large numbers to participate in rituals and celebrations.

  • Seasonal Tips: Avoid visiting during peak summer months, as the heat can be intense. Winter and monsoon seasons offer a more pleasant experience.
  • Festival Highlights: Festivals like Paryushan and Mahavir Jayanti are celebrated with grandeur, providing an enriched cultural experience.
